Lotte Construction Implements Flexible Dress Code for Employees View original image


[Asia Economy Reporter Donghyun Choi] Lotte Construction announced on the 15th that it will implement a dress code autonomy policy for all employees.


Lotte Construction had previously designated every Friday as a "Casual Day," allowing employees to come to work in casual attire. However, following Lotte Holdings' recent decision to adopt dress code autonomy, the company has decided to implement this new policy. This move is based on the judgment that it will enhance work efficiency and create a more flexible working environment.


From now on, all employees of Lotte Construction can freely wear casual clothing (such as round-neck T-shirts, jeans, sneakers), business casual, or business formal attire as their work clothes. Employees are encouraged to autonomously choose comfortable attire considering their individual job characteristics, work situations, and locations.


A Lotte Construction official stated, "We decided to allow dress code autonomy to move away from a formal and rigid atmosphere and create a freer and more comfortable working environment," adding, "We expect this policy to improve employees' work efficiency and satisfaction."



Meanwhile, Lotte Construction operates various morale-boosting programs such as 'Fun Day' (supporting cultural and sports events), providing best-selling books, supporting overseas family trips for employees, as well as work-family balance programs including mandatory paternity leave for men and Family Love Day.
